Full Stack Developer (Java & Angular)
Neev · Galway
Job description
About the role
We are seeking a skilled Full Stack Developer to design, develop, and maintain high‑performance web applications. You will work across the entire technology stack, creating responsive front‑end interfaces and robust back‑end services while managing cloud‑based deployments.
Key responsibilities
- Architect and develop scalable Single Page Applications (SPAs) using Angular, focusing on high‑performance data rendering and reactive state management.
- Design and implement microservices with Java and Spring Boot, ensuring security, scalability, and integration with asynchronous messaging systems.
- Manage data persistence using relational databases such as PostgreSQL and NoSQL solutions, optimizing storage and access patterns.
- Deploy and operate applications in cloud environments (AWS or Azure) using Docker and Kubernetes for consistent, containerized delivery.
- Build, document, and maintain RESTful APIs that enable seamless communication between front‑end and back‑end components.
- Participate in code reviews, write unit and integration tests, and uphold high standards of code modularity and documentation.
Required profile
- Strong problem‑solving abilities to troubleshoot complex technical issues across multiple layers.
- Excellent collaboration and communication skills for working within cross‑functional agile teams.
- Adaptable, continuous learner who stays updated with emerging technologies and industry trends.
Required skills
- Angular, TypeScript, HTML5, CSS3, NgRx
- Java, Spring Boot, Spring Cloud, Spring Security
- Microservices architecture and design
- Apache Kafka for asynchronous messaging
- AWS services (EKS, S3, RDS) or equivalent Azure services
- Docker, Kubernetes
- PostgreSQL, relational databases, NoSQL solutions
- Git, CI/CD pipelines, Maven/Gradle
Questions fréquentes
Why are you reporting this job?
Apply in 30 seconds
Enter your email to apply. An account will be created automatically.
By continuing, you accept our terms of use.
Already have an account? Login
Published 1 day ago
Expires 1 month from now
9 views · 0 applications
Boost your chances
Upload your CV — we will match you with relevant openings.
Analyzing your CV...
Neev
Galway